使用函数创建一个过滤查询

使用类:public class FunctionRangeQParserPlugin extends QParserPlugin

通过函数创建一个范围查询:
其他参数:
l, 下限范围,可选)
u, 上限范围,可选)
incl, 包含下限:true/false,可选,默认为true
incu, 包含上限:true/false,可选,默认为true
例子: {!frange l=1000 u=50000}myfield
过滤查询例子:: fq={!frange l=0 u=2.2}sum(user_ranking,editor_ranking)

 

posted @ 2015-03-30 14:25  勿妄  阅读(212)  评论(0编辑  收藏  举报